What You're Getting

Sony's Cognitive Processor XR delivers a picture with wide dynamic contrast, detailed blacks, and natural colors that aim to replicate real-world vision. QD-OLED technology paired with XR Triluminos Max provides a wide palette of shades and hues matched by pure OLED black and high brightness. The TV runs Google TV for streaming access and voice control via Google Assistant, plus it supports Apple AirPlay. For movie buffs, BRAVIA CORE offers high-bitrate 4K UHD movie streaming with included credits.

Gamers get HDMI 2.1 features like 4K/120, VRR, and ALLM, plus a dedicated Game Menu that centralizes all gaming settings and assist features.
